Dripping faucet repair services focus on fixing faucets that leak or continuously drip, which can be a common issue in many homes and properties. This service involves diagnosing the cause of the leak, which might be due to worn-out washers, damaged valves, or corroded parts. Once the problem is identified, service providers can replace or repair the faulty components to restore proper function and eliminate the dripping sound. Addressing a dripping faucet not only improves the appearance and sound of a kitchen or bathroom but also helps prevent further damage to plumbing fixtures.

Leaking faucets can lead to several problems if left unaddressed. Continuous drips can cause increased water bills over time, as even small leaks waste significant amounts of water. Additionally, persistent leaks may lead to water damage around fixtures, resulting in mold growth or deterioration of cabinetry and flooring. In some cases, a faulty faucet can cause water pressure issues or lead to more serious plumbing problems if the leak worsens. Repairing or replacing a leaking faucet promptly can help homeowners avoid these costly issues and maintain a functional, efficient plumbing system.

The overview below groups typical Dripping Faucet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Renton,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or faucet repairs in Renton range from $100 to $250. Many routine fixes, such as fixing leaks or replacing washers, fall within this band.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this range.

Mid-Range Repairs - More involved repairs, like replacing a faucet cartridge or addressing multiple leaks, usually cost between $250 and $600. These are common for many local jobs and represent the middle of typical project costs.

Full Faucet Replacement - Replacing an entire faucet typically costs between $600 and $1,200, depending on the model and complexity. Larger, more custom installations can push beyond this range but are less common for standard homes.

Complex Plumbing Projects - Larger or more complex faucet-related projects, such as extensive plumbing modifications, can reach $1,500 or more. These are less frequent and usually involve additional plumbing work beyond simple faucet rep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a dripping faucet? A dripping faucet is often caused by worn-out washers, damaged valve seats, or loose parts that allow water to escape even when the faucet is turned off.

Can a leaking faucet waste a lot of water? Yes, a constantly dripping faucet can lead to significant water waste over time, increasing utility bills and affecting water conservation efforts.

Is it possible to fix a dripping faucet without professional help? Some minor repairs can be handled by homeowners, but for a reliable and long-lasting fix, it’s recommended to contact local contractors experienced in faucet repairs.

What types of faucets can local service providers repair? They can typically repair various types of faucets, including compression, cartridge, ball, and ceramic disc faucets.
